examples/var_service: use "exec sleep 5" instead of "{ sleep 5; exit; }"
[oweals/busybox.git] / examples / var_service / svpage
1 #!/bin/sh
2
3 test "$1" || {
4         echo "Syntax: ${0##*/} SERVICE"
5         exit 1
6 }
7
8 test x"$1" = x"${1#*/}" -a x"$1" != x"." && {
9         # has no slashes and is not a "."
10         cd "/var/service/$1" || exit $?
11         set -- "."
12 }
13
14 test -x "$1/page" && exec "$1/page"
15
16 cd "log/logdir" || exit $?
17
18 test "$PAGER" || PAGER=less
19 cat @* current | $PAGER